The paper investigates a multi-stage investment problem under Conditional Value at Risk (CVaR) constraints with: a given security level for bankruptcy, short selling permission, a normal and an elliptical total return distribution models. The purpose of the work is to find a method of determining the optimal investment in this problem at each stage. As a result of the study, an optimal investment strategy is found and it is shown that the optimal investment portfolio at each stage does not depend on the value of the investor’s capital, but depends only on the number of stage. It is shown that the multi-stage problem can be reduced to a finite number of one-stage optimization problems, which are problems of conic programming. For the one-stage problem, conditions for the non-emptiness of the set of admissible portfolios are given and the Kuhn–Tucker theorem is applied. Additionally, this paper presents a numerical example of finding the optimal investment based on the open data on rates of assert prices of companies on the stock exchange.

A relevant and highly demanded modern medicine problem in many of its areas is the timely detection and recognition of pathogenic microorganisms and microbial communities in the patient’s tissues for the speedy prescription and correct use of medicines from mutually exclusive tactics. The transition to a new level in the speed of visualization of the samples’ contents taken and the accuracy of diagnostics is possible because of the use of lanthanide staining in combination with scanning electron microscopy to retrieve a series of high-resolution images with subsequent automatic labelling and classification of microbiological objects. This paper presents the results of using the YOLOv5 neural network model to detect 15 different most common opportunistic classes of bacteria in 380 images. As a result, a 71.5% average accuracy and 69.8% recall were achieved by using the YOLOv5 base model without freezing layers.

AIM:To evaluate the possibilities of textural analysis of 3D models in differentiating the degree of nuclear dysplasia of the clear cell renal cell carcinoma (ccRCC).MATERIALS AND METHODS:The specimens after surgical treatment of 190 patients with ccRCC were analyzed. In all cases, nephron-sparing surgery (NSS) was performed through laparoscopic access. The clinical characteristics were evaluated, including age, gender, tumor localization (side, surface and segments), absolute tumor volume, Charlson comorbidity index, body mass index, nephrometry scores (RENAL, PADOVA, C-index). Patients were divided into 2 groups. In group 1, there were 119 patients with the ccRCC of Grade 1 or 2, while group 2 consisted of 71 patients with ccRCC of Grade 3 and 4. All patients underwent 3D virtual planning of procedure using the 3D modeling program "Amira". At the first stage, two experienced radiologists performed manual segmentation of 3D models of kidney parenchyma tumors. At the second stage, the tumor shape was analyzed with a mathematical calculation of three indicators and more than 300 textural features of statistics of types 1-2 were extracted. Further, an intellectual analysis was carried out. For the evaluation of tumor grade according to Furman system, the classification problem was solved using the machine learning algorithm Stochastic Gradient Descent and cross-validation k=5.RESULTS:The accuracy of classification for the two groups of Grade 1 or 2 and Grade 3 or 4 on the F1 metric was 72.2. To build the model, the following parameters were selected: the absolute tumor volume, the Charlson comorbidity index, "Energy", the first quartile and the second decile of the pixel intensity distribution.CONCLUSION:The texture analysis of 3D models for the prediction of Fuhrman grade in ccRCC demonstrated satisfactory quality for two groups of Grade 1 or 2 and Grade 3 or 4 nuclear dysplasia.
The problem of designing an optimal insurance strategy in a modification of the risk process with discrete time is investigated. This model introduces stage-by-stage probabilistic constraints (Value-at-Risk (VaR) constraints) on the insurer's capital increments during each stage. Also, the set of admissible insurances is determined by a safety level reflecting a 'good' or 'bad' capital increment at the previous stage. The mathematical expectation of the insurer's final capital is used as the objective functional. The total loss of the insurer at each stage is modeled by the Gaussian (normal) distribution with parameters depending on a seded loss function (or, in other words, an insurance policy) selected. In contrast to traditional dynamic optimization models for insurance strategies, the proposed approach allows to construct the value functions (and hence the optimal insurance policies) by simply solving a sequence of static insurance optimization problems. It is demonstrated that the optimal seded loss function at each stage depends on the prescribed value of the safety level: it is either a stop-loss insurance or conditional deductible insurance having a discontinuous point. In order to reduce ex post moral hazard, we also investigate the case, where both parties in an insurance contract are obligated to pay more for a larger realization of loss. This leads to that the optimal seeded loss functions are either stop-loss insurances or unconditional deductible insurances.
Currently, instrumental brain imaging plays a significant role in the examination of patients with cognitive impairment. It is important for diagnostic process, prognosis of the course of neurodegenerative, cerebrovascular and other diseases, clarification of the role of individual brain structures and systems in the development of cognitive and other neuropsychiatric disorders. The purpose of the study was to analyze the volumes of the medial temporal lobes (MTL), hippocampus and brain volume in middle-aged patients with pre-mild cognitive decline. Material and methods. 38 patients (33 women, 5 men) of middle age (60.77 ± 9.4 years) were examined. Patients were divided into two groups: with subjective cognitive decline (SCD) – 15 patients, aged 53.5 ± 6.94 years and subtle cognitive decline (StCD) – 23 people aged 63.35 ± 8.64 years (groups statistically did not differ in age). All patients underwent a neuropsychological examination with an assessment of the cognitive sphere, magnetic resonance imaging of the brain, including the assessment of the presence and degree of microangiopathy (MAP), morphometry of the medial temporal lobes, hippocampus, brain volume and a study for the presence of the allele of the apolyprotein E gene (ApoE4). Results. A decrease in the average and total hippocampal volume was found in patients with StCD compared to patients with SCD. Also, MAP was significantly more common in patients with StCD. There were no differences in the degree of MTL atrophy. A decrease in the volume of the left hippocampus was revealed in patients with aggravated heredity for dementia. The average and total volume of the hippocampus is reduced in carriers of the ApoE4 allele of the apolyprotein gene. Correlation analysis showed the relationship between the average volume of the hippocampus and the volume of the brain.

The paper presents a constructive description of the set of all efficient (Pareto-optimal) investment portfolios in a new setting, where the risk measure named “shortfall probability” (SP) is understood as the probability of a shortfall of investor’s capital below a prescribed level. Under a normality assumption, it is shown that SP has a generalized convexity property, the set efficient portfolios is constructed. Relations between the set of mean-SP and the set of mean-variance efficient portfolios as well as between mean-SP and mean-Value-at-Risk (VaR) sets of efficient portfolios are studied. It turns out that mean-SP efficient set is a proper subset of the mean-variance efficient set; interrelation with the mean-VaR efficient set is more complicated, however, mean-SP efficient set is proved to be a proper subset of mean-VaR efficient set under a sufficiently high confidence level. Besides a normal distribution, elliptic distributions are considered as an alternative for modeling the investor’s total return distribution. The obtained results provides the investor with a risk measure, that is more vivid than the variance and Value-at-Risk, and with determination of the corresponding set of effective portfolios.
The article is devoted to the problem of diagnosing subclinical keratoconus (KK). The need to identify early signs of KK is primarily associated with the potential for the development of iatrogenic keratoectasia in cases of underdiagnosis of the disease when determining the conditions for laser keratorefractive surgery involving a decrease in the thickness of the cornea. Today generally accepted algorithms for early computer-assisted diagnosis of KK are mainly based on the analysis of various morphometric parameters of the cornea, reflecting changes in its shape and thickness induced by structural abnormalities. Direct detection of structural changes in the cornea characteristic of early KK requires the use of high-tech imaging methods that are not always applicable in everyday clinical practice. The promising approach proposed in this study is based on the fact that a digital image of a corneal «slice» obtained using serial analyzers such as the Scheimpflug camera widely used in clinical practice provides indirect information about the structure of the epithelial layer, the local thickening of which takes place in the initial stages KK. It is this criterion that underlies the proposed system of computer-assisted diagnosis of KK. The carried out studies have shown the high sensitivity of this algorithm, and its specificity can be increased by involving the known diagnostic indicators of KK.
As a result of a sharp popularity increase of artificial intelligence resource-intensive methods, a serious problem arises in the preliminary data preparation for the convolutional neural networks models effective training. The authors present an approach based on the training dataset iterative updating principle using the YOLO neural network model for areas of interest detection, objects selection, and the original images labeling process automation. The proposed approach was tested with various model configurations for bacteria labeling on images obtained using a scanning electron microscope and, on average, demonstrated ~90% precision on a training dataset increased by 1.75 times over the initial training dataset.

The paper considers an integrated approach for constructing models for predicting the perioperative parameters of laparoscopic kidney resections, which include the duration of the operation, the time of thermal ischemia, and the glomerular filtration rate 24 hours after the operation. The approach is based on the principle of expanding the feature space, extracted from the analysis of the surgeon's "learning curve" data when mastering laparoscopic kidney resections. The aim of this work is to predict the main perioperative parameters that have the most significant impact on the surgical tactics of treatment at the stage of planning surgery. New methods have been developed for identifying significant parameters that take into account the complexity of the operation and the qualifications of the surgeon based on his “learning curve”. The parameters to be distinguished include: “complexity of the operation” based on nephrometric indices (RENAL, PADUA and C-index); the average value of the predicted perioperative parameters of surgical interventions depending on the complexity; slope and standard error based on the regression line of predicted perioperative parameters. Models were developed for predicting the perioperative parameters of laparoscopic organ-preserving kidney interventions using modern approaches based on machine learning, which are based on the algorithms “decision trees”, “multilayer perceptron”, “Naïve Bayes”, “logistic regression”. A comparative analysis of the quality of the developed models was carried out, as a result of which the best result was obtained using the “logistic regression” algorithm. The F-measure was used as a metric. A comparative analysis of the developed models was carried out to assess the impact on the final quality of the new selected features. For the predicted parameter “time of thermal ischemia” the increase was from 9.68% to 16.68%; for the predicted parameter “duration of surgery” the increase was from 2.76% to 4.08%. At the same time, for the predicted parameter “GFR in 24 hours” there was no significant increase, and for the “multilayer perceptron” algorithm it turned out to be negative. The obtained forecasting models can be used in applied software solutions that act as decision support systems in determining the surgical tactics of treating patients with localized formations of the renal parenchyma. Such software solutions can be implemented as a web service or as a separate program.
The progress of cognitive impairments at the initial stage is poorly researched and is difficult to be diagnosed. This paper proposes an integrated approach based on the initial data analysis and the subsystem construction to predict the progression of further complications in patients with cognitive impairment symptoms. The combined use of statistical analysis and machine learning methods made it possible to achieve 78% accuracy in diagnosing subtle cognitive impairments in a sample of 526 patients. Visualization methods helped to improve the created model’s interpretability.
